My 1983 Mercury Cougar won't start unless you take a test light, hook it up to the battery and then take the test part and touch the coil. It will then start. You can start it several times after that and then it will go back to the same thing. Then you have to use the test light again to start it. In what part of the wiring could be bad causing this?
